Workforce training platform Uvaro acquired coding school Lighthouse Labs this past January. This past January, Kitchener-Waterloo, Ont.-based workforce training platform Uvaro acquired coding school Lighthouse Labs for an undisclosed amount, making it a subsidiary. Just over seven months later, both have filed for bankruptcy. As first reported by Canadian Cyber in Context, the two…

The Department of Justice (DOJ) blocked Spirit Airlines’ merger with JetBlue in order to preserve competition in the domestic airline industry. Now, it looks like Spirit may go under. In July 2022, JetBlue announced its acquisition of the foundering Spirit Airlines, which reported a net loss of $36 million in the third quarter of 2022…
